According to the BBC, the Greenland shark is the longest-living vertebrate known on Earth, with a lifespan that researchers estimate reaches roughly 400 years, challenging fundamental biological understandings of aging. These deep-sea predators inhabit the cold, dark waters of the North Atlantic and Arctic oceans, where slow metabolic rates and unique physiological adaptations allow them to survive centuries of environmental change.
Greenland Shark Lifespan and Deep-Sea Biology
Scientists debate the true longevity limit of the species, with estimates generally ranging between 300 and 500 years. According to the BBC, surviving specimens alive today may have been swimming in Arctic waters since the era of William Shakespeare in 1616 or the French Revolution in 1789. This extraordinary lifespan unfolds in deep waters where temperatures hover around zero degrees Celsius and water pressure is extreme, creating an environment where biological processes run at a vastly reduced pace.
The Rare Discovery of a 150-Year-Old Specimen in Ireland
In April, a dead Greenland shark washed ashore on a beach in County Sligo, Ireland, marking the first recorded instance of the species stranding on the country’s coast. According to the Irish Whale and Dolphin Group, the 3-meter-long animal weighed over 200 kilograms and was roughly 150 years old. Emilie De Loose, a marine biologist with the organization cited by the BBC, noted that despite its massive size, the shark was barely reaching sexual maturity. “Atingiu agora a idade em que poderia começar a reproduzir-se e contribuir para o equilíbrio da população,” De Loose stated, emphasizing that losing a single individual wipes out more than a century of extremely slow growth.
Did you know? Greenland sharks take more than a century to reach sexual maturity. Because they reproduce so slowly, scientists face severe challenges in tracking population numbers and protecting the species from accidental bycatch in commercial fishing nets.
Anatomical Secrets: Hearts, Eyes, and DNA Repair
Researchers transporting the stranded shark to the National Museum of Ireland initiated a multi-year autopsy, harvesting samples of skin, muscle, organs, heart, eyes, and the digestive tract. According to recent scientific investigations, the 34-kilogram heart of the Greenland shark exhibits resilience against age-related cardiovascular decline despite showing normal wear and tear. Furthermore, studies published this year reveal that retinal cells remain healthy and specialized for low-light conditions, defying earlier assumptions that parasitic copepods blindingly degrade their vision over centuries. At the cellular level, researchers found that genes responsible for repairing genetic DNA damage remain particularly active, pointing to potential biological mechanisms that suppress the accumulation of age-related lesions.
Persistent Mysteries of Arctic Predators
Despite decades of marine research, basic life-history traits of the species remain largely unknown. According to Brynn Devine, a marine biologist with the conservation organization Oceans North cited by the BBC, scientists still cannot locate where the sharks mate, where females give birth, or the size of the total population. Compounding these knowledge gaps is their hunting behavior; although slow-moving, researchers discovered these predators successfully capture fast-swimming seals in total darkness, likely by ambushing resting or ice-trapped prey.
Frequently Asked Questions
How long do Greenland sharks live?
According to the BBC, Greenland sharks are the longest-living vertebrates on Earth, with scientific estimates placing their lifespan between 300 and 400 years, and potentially up to 500 years.
Where do Greenland sharks live?
They inhabit the deep, cold waters of the North Atlantic Ocean and the Arctic Ocean, where sunlight barely reaches and water temperatures stay near freezing.
At what age do Greenland sharks reproduce?
Greenland sharks take more than 100 years to reach sexual maturity, meaning a 150-year-old specimen is only just entering its reproductive years.
What do Greenland sharks eat?
While historically believed to scavenge on whale and fish carcasses found on the ocean floor, recent findings show they actively hunt fast-moving prey such as seals in the dark Arctic depths.
